Security concerns affecting businesses and governments

During the pandemic, potential privacy risks from TikTok and FaceApp have affected large companies and their personnel. Both financial services company Wells Fargo and American multinational tech giant Amazon have encouraged their employees to delete the TikTok app from their mobile devices. Even though companies did not state specific threats to user data, the distrust surrounding the company and its ties to China has forced the company to take action to regain the trust of its users. TikTok ensures that non-Chinese user data cannot be stored in China nor is it subject to China’s law.

Around the world, the usage of TikTok and FaceApp apps is often strongly discouraged for politicians and government officials. However, there are cases where motives for negative publicity are political attacks against China. Big neighboring countries like India, Indonesia, Pakistan, and Bangladesh have used temporary blocks and warnings to eliminate or discourage usage of the app. Even the former US President Trump proposed to ban TikTok due to potential national security threats.

Should you be concerned?

After all these accusations, should you be concerned about your data on these platforms? The reality of a private user of social media networks is unfortunate. Not just TikTok, but tech giants like Google and Facebook already utilize our information for financial gains. The appealing content format tracks your video completion rate, liked videos, hashtags, and used songs. For new users, geolocation extracted from your IP address helps the algorithm supply you with local, perhaps familiar content.

The days of internet privacy are over. Most internet users are dependent on social media networks and see no trouble trading personal information for convenience. Because these services are available for free, companies treat information as a form of payment, turning users into products.

Reduce your digital footprint

Even if complete privacy is unachievable, some tools help us reduce tracking on the web. User-agents contained in data packets show receivers your browser version and operating system. Along with them, residential proxies allow web users to transmit their data packets through an intermediary server in any location around the world.

Proxy providers supply clients with a large pool of IP addresses to give different options for network identity changes. While a random IP will already make your connection to the web more private, some local addresses will help you access geo-blocked websites that otherwise would not be available in your region.

Using proxy servers is a great way to protect your browsing experience, but they have little to no effect if you connect to TikTok and other social media platforms through a registered account. The only way to truly protect user data in a social media revolution is to break the cycle and quit using these platforms.
